Welding certification

NECIT is appointed by the Department for Business and Trade (DBT) as a Recognised Third Party Organisation (RTPO) for the approval of Welders, Welding operators, and Welding procedures.

This is a big deal! Here’s what it means:

For Welder and fabrication companies: NECIT’s certification enables welders and fabrication companies’ welding procedures to comply with the PESR. T PESR applies to the design, manufacture and conformity assessment of pressure equipment and parts that have to handle a maximum pressure greater than 0.5 bar.

What NECIT does: As a chosen RTPO, NECIT makes sure that the joining personnel and the procedures meet international standards. If everything checks out, appropriate approval documentation is issued based on a successful evaluation.

Non-Destructive Testing (NDT)

NDT is a way of examining materials or components without causing any damage. In simpler terms, it’s a “look-but-don’t-touch” method of testing and here are our testing techniques:

  1. Visual Inspection: Just as it sounds, we simply look at the material or component and spot surface flaws, corrosion, and other irregularities.
  2. Penetrant Inspection (Colour Contrast & Fluorescent): Think of this as a spotlight on a stage when an actor forgets their line, the spotlight makes them the centre of attention. Similarly, we apply a special liquid to a surface and this liquid seeps into any flaws, making them easier to see, especially under special lighting.
  3. Magnetic Particle Inspection (Colour Contrast & Fluorescent): We magnetise a part and then sprinkle it with magnetic particles. These particles are attracted to areas with defects, making them visible to the naked eye.
  4. Ultrasonic Thickness & Shearwave Testing: Sending sound waves into an object, and then measuring how they bounce back gives us insights into any potential flaws.
  5. Phased Array Ultrasonic Testing & Corrosion Mapping: Imagine a radar scanning the skies for planes. Likewise, we use sound waves to create a map that shows flaws or corrosion inside a material.
